Step inside the Anaheim Convention Center and you immediately sense the scale of possibility. As the largest exhibit facility on the entire West Coast, this venue serves as the central economic engine for the region, welcoming over 1.5 million visitors annually. From sprawling trade shows to intimate corporate gatherings, the layout is engineered for efficiency and impact.

Navigating the South Hall and North Hall
The venue is divided into distinct yet connected zones, primarily the South Hall and the North Hall. The South Hall handles the largest exhibitions, often featuring international scale events where thousands of booths line the vast floor plate. The North Hall, while slightly more intimate, hosts specialized conventions and breakout sessions, providing a balance between the massive and the meticulous.

Meeting Rooms and Business Centers
Scattered throughout the complex are over 100 meeting rooms, ranging from small huddle spaces to grand ballrooms. These rooms are soundproofed and equipped with state-of-the-art audiovisual technology, ensuring that sensitive negotiations or strategic planning sessions remain private. The on-site business center provides support for printing, copying, and last-minute administrative needs, keeping businesses productive on the go.
